Inguinal hernia repair with mesh has a high incidence of postoperative chronic pain. Transversus abdominis plane block is a current intervention to support postoperative analgesia, however it is recently in research area how to be applied in different surgical areas to be more effective than intravenous opioids. Subcostal transversus abdominis plane block is not advised but has not been studied to be effective for postoperative analgesia in inguinal herniography patients. This study aims to research the effect of subcostal transversus abdominis plane block in subacute postoperative pain after inguinal hernia repair
Patients were divided into two groups, one is control and the second is subcostal transversus abdominis plane block (STAP) group. After standard general anesthesia application, control group ( Group I) had 1 gram of paracetamol and 100 mg of contramal just after starting surgical closure. Group II (STAP) had 1 gram of paracetamol and 100 mg of contramal, after surgical closure transversus abdominis plane block in subcostal area was applied to the patient.
